The Science Behind Vinegar and Drain Cleaning

Vinegar is a natural acid that can help break down and dissolve grease, hair, and other debris that can clog your drains. When you pour vinegar down your drain, it can help to:

  • Break down fatty acids and oils that can cause blockages
  • Dissolve mineral deposits that can build up in your pipes
  • Help to clear hair and other debris that can clog your drains

Using Vinegar to Unclog Drains

To use vinegar to unclog your drains, you'll need to mix it with baking soda. Here's a simple recipe:

  1. Pour 1 cup of baking soda down your drain
  2. Follow with 1 cup of vinegar
  3. Let the mixture sit for a few hours or overnight
  4. Pour hot water down your drain to rinse

Does Vinegar Really Work?

While vinegar can be a helpful tool in maintaining your drains and preventing blockages, it may not be enough to completely unblock a clogged drain. If you have a severe blockage, you may need to use a combination of methods, including:

  • Using a plunger or drain rods to physically remove the blockage
  • Using a high-pressure water jetting system to clear the blockage
  • Calling a professional drainage company to diagnose and fix the problem
